I'm using a POD HD Pro X, connected to my PC and used as an audio interface as well as a sound card. What I noticed is that the output volume of my guitars and basses is pretty low, but the volume for everything else like Chrome or games is really high. I'm using the master knob on 25% when watching Youtube, but need to crank it at least to 50% to have decent volume for my instruments. 

Makes it annoying to play along to music.

I also don't crank the amp volume to 100% because that causes tons of clipping, so that makes the issue even worse.

Any ideas?

If your POD is set as the OS's main AI you can open the OS's mixer volume control panel to balance all the sources/apps currently outputting audio.

Right click on the speaker icon in the system try to open the audio menu and select "open mixer volume"

Well yeah, obviously I can do that. But why is 100% on my OS extremely loud, but 100% in the amp, which produces digital clipping, is extremely low?

 

What you have to do simply is to lower the volume of the apps outputting audio.
It is neither necessary nor advisable to max out the amp models volume parameters.

 

Once you find a good Master Volume knob setting for your guitars, leave it there and dont' touch it anymore.

Adjust only the other audio sources.


You can test the good functioning of your POD when you open a DAW and all the audio is managed only internally to the app (ie excluding external media players and the like), if your just recorded tracks playback is quite balanced with your live playing it means that your POD is performing perfectly well.


However it happens that the multimedia playback clean volume offered through the POD is very generous (better to have much than little, especially to get the best signal/noise ratio), just cut out the excess you don't need.

 

Also, if your device is connected through the 1/4" jack outputs to any flat response amplification system make sure the 1/4" OUT switch near the pedal is set to LINE.
